Abstract :
Image detection has been widely used in such fields as geometric measurement, industrial quality inspection, three-dimensional surface detection and so on. Because most of the image detection algorithms are effective for specific problems, there is no kind of detection algorithm can be applied for all image detection problems. An accurate detection of the vascular network in medical images from various organs can help physicians to plan their surgical operations. In this paper, we propose a new adaptive medialness measure method for detection of vascular network. The adaptiveness of the medialness is based on the eigenvectors and eigenvalues of the Hessian matrix of the image. In this method, we describe the measure of medialness and ridge, then we use a toric circular model of a vessel to illustrate our detection, we express the relationship between the size of the structure and its selected scale. From this relationship, we explain the extraction of the local extrema and make a full reconstruction of the vascular network. Eventually synthetic images are used to validate the detailed study and show the behavior of the algorithm under the suggested vascular model.
